Ratty, needle felted and shaded with soft pastels.
Standing just 2.5 inches high Ratty has such “hello eyes”. Needle felted with wired and thread jointed upper limbs and a wire armature tail.
The main colour is flesh tone merino wool top then shaded with artist soft pastels, and of course his white wool teeth.
This whiskers are human hair! My daughter had some hair wefts that are used to make hair extensions they worked, what do you think?
